The twenty members of the Camera 1, C H 55 5 E Q Club spent the year delving into the finer S points of the photographic arts. Such as de- veloping, printing, enlarging and taking pic- tures. This year's officers were: Barbara Er- fourth, Chief Photographer, Elvyna Herbst, Assistant Photographer, and Larry Maples, Scribe. 17 I 1 One of the outstanding features of this years program was the first full length movie made in 1903, The Great Train Robbery. It was shown by the club at the Carnival. ' . ROW ROW ROW ROW Choir Sturgeon Bay High School's active choir, directed by Mr. Tom Runkle, gives students the opportunity to learn the finer points of singing, whether as solo work or blending voices with the choir or ensembles. In ad- dition to the Christmas concert and the Spring concert, the choir participated in the District Music Festival which was held in Sturgeon Bay this year under the sponsor- ship of the local music department. Singers who were able to receive the first-star rating which enabled them to compete in the state tournament in Madison were Mary Solomon, Jean Schmidt, Dave Warren, Ken Sterling, Phil Prange, and Bill Boler.
